1968 Sat 6 April
April 6, 1968

I didn’t want to make rules for Auroville, but I am going to be forced to start formulating certain things, because… there happens to be difficulties. I don’t know what to do.

What I wanted to say came; it’s very simple (Mother takes a written note), simply like this (it’s about very small things):

“One must choose between getting drunk and living in Auroville, the two are incompatible.”

It’s not an innocent drunkenness, I mean it results in acts of violence, it verges on madness.

So of course, if we start along this road, we may also say this (Mother takes another note):

“One must choose between living in falsehood and living in Auroville, the two are incompatible.”

May it be true!

We could say that those who get drunk do it to forget; but one doesn’t come to Auroville to forget: one comes to Auroville, on the contrary, to remember.

Yes, we might rather put it in that form.

But the idea was mostly to insist on the CHOICE. Living in Auroville is a CHOICE. It’s a choice, an attitude you adopt, a decision you make. Living in Auroville is a choice, you choose a certain life. But once you choose one thing, some others become incompatible…. At any rate, living in Auroville is an ACTION, a decision you make, an action.

But this (Mother points to her note) is a concession to the present state of mankind, because, to tell the truth, in Auroville there should only be individual cases. What I mean is this: there may be people who get drunk and are nonetheless fit to live in Auroville. So we can’t make a general rule. But if we don’t make a general rule, on what ground can we say to someone (who’s been accepted, that’s the difficulty), “No, you must change—either you stop this, or else you can’t stay in Auroville…”?

What is said of alcohol can be said of drugs; and it can be said of many other things.

Many, yes, lots. It’s only a beginning. You understand, I have seen that we’re going to be faced with the need… It’s the need to impose a choice—to say, “You must choose between this and that.”

It’s the same with drugs, in some people the effects aren’t dangerous, or not harmful.

Ultimately, everyone’s freedom is limited by the fact that it mustn’t go against others’ freedom. That’s the limit.

Obviously it’s hard to make general rules.

It’s impossible.

In my case, I remember having taken opium for several years, and it did me good, it would soothe me, quiet me. Taking opium now would be absurd, but at the time it did me no harm.

But of course! I understand that very well! I see it so clearly, in such a universal way…. You see, a sentence like this (Mother shows her note) ought to be said to only one individual, that is, “It’s like this FOR YOU—you must choose between overcoming your weakness or habit and living in Auroville, the two can’t go together.” But then, it becomes a purely individual question; to another you may well not need to say it.

That’s why the most general formula is to say that any self-forgetfulness is contrary to life in Auroville. One doesn’t go to Auroville to forget, or to forget oneself—any self-forgetfulness, in any form.

Ah, but “self-forgetfulness,” if you take it from a moral standpoint…! (Mother laughs)

Forgetting one’s true self.

(Mother laughs) The minute one formulates…

It would be more correct to say:

“Any pursuit of unconsciousness is contrary to life in Auroville.”

That’s more general. And if we want to be still more general, we could say,

“Any movement backward or downward is in contradiction to life in Auroville, which is a life of ascent towards the future.”

But words…

Some articles have appeared in newspapers about Auroville’s foundation, for instance with the theme, “A utopia on the way to realization.” So then, there are those who tell you, “You’ll never succeed!” Their argument is, “They are human beings and they will remain human”—that’s where they’re wrong. “Human nature cannot be changed,” that’s the basis on which they tell you, “You won’t succeed.” Therefore the only thing needed is not only to accept and to want the future, but to adhere to the will for transformation and progress. As a general formula, that’s quite fine.

But you see, with drugs, for instance—take chloroform used for operations: well, on every individual chloroform has different effects (they don’t accept that in theory, but it’s a fact). We have S. here, who was an anesthetist, and the upshot of his experience is that it has a different effect on everyone. Some it hurls into unconsciousness (the large majority, I think), but in certain cases, on the contrary, people are thrown into another consciousness.

And it’s the same with everything.

So my note won’t do, it can only do individually: “That’s how it is in your case”; but in another case, it may not be incompatible at all.

So we’ll have to deal with it little by little…. It’ll be interesting!
